Cutter’s Cigar Emporium has recently moved to 4915 Winward Parkway, ste 100 (Next to Mambo’s cafe). Several feet away from this building is situated the residential community called Cogburn Walk.
The noise level has gone up and we can strongly smell the cigar smoke coming from that area. We have many small children in our subdivision. I am allergic to the cigar/cigarette smell and I have a 4 year old child who is getting exposed to second hand smoke.
They placed tables facing the houses in our subdivision near the chain link fence. We do not feel safe going to our deck with strangers looking at our house and we fear the situation will get worse during winter when the leaves are gone.
We also fear that property values in our subdivision will decrease due to the proximity/exposure to the crowd and cigar/cigarette smell.

Also, people are sitting so close to the chain link fence if they accidentally throw cigarette butts over the fence it can start a fire easily on a dry day.

At this time, we urge the city to protect the health, wellbeing and privacy of the residents of this community. We request the following:
1. Extend the retaining wall so our subdivision is not visible from the patio.
2. Ensure all music entertainment is conducted within the interior of the building and no outdoor speakers are permitted.
3. Move the patio/ arrange tables in such manner that the smoke smell does not travel towards Cogburn Walk.
